The Silver Cross Slumber Bedside Crib Travel CotThis bedside crib, made for divan beds is easy to put together. The instructions can be a bit difficult to follow because there is a specific order you have to follow to arrange the pieces, but MFM users said it was very intuitive after they had gotten used to it.
It is also able to fold very quickly, compactly and can be tucked away in its own travel bag.
Easy to assemble
If you're in search of a travel cot that's simple to move around and set up, look no further than the Silver Cross Slumber. It's designed to function as an ideal bedside crib, keeping your baby bedside cot close at all times of the night and allowing you to feed your child without having to get out of bed. It is also lightweight and compact, making it ideal for traveling.
The crib is easy to put together using poles that you can bend into positions and a sheet that pops over the mattress. Once it's up and you're ready to put your baby into. Emily, a mum test subject, says it took her two tries to master the assembly, but once she mastered it, it was easy. Her daughter also did well sleeping.
It includes a foldable mattress as well as a baby bassinet, so it is suitable from birth. It has a side zip so you can lay next to your baby and observe them sleeping. Then, roll them into the crib for safety and zip it up. This is a great option if you're used to co sleeper bedside cot-sleeping and would like to continue this for as long as you can.
When you're ready to pack it up, the crib folds down in one swift move and then tucks away in its own carry bag - a good idea if you're planning to travel. This is a great option for those who are moving or have guests staying for several days.

The SnuzPod 4 is sleeker than some bedside cribs but it still allows plenty of space for your baby to rest comfortably. It features a ComfortAir air-conditioned mattress that regulates your baby's temperature and comes with an optional reflux incline that can help alleviate your baby's reflux. Home testers loved the slim frame and the ease with which it can be affixed to a variety of beds. A mum on the BabyCentre Forum warns that this model may not fit certain divan beds as the straps are too long and do not extend to the base of the mattress.
Another mom on the BabyCentre forum recommends checking out a YouTube video before purchasing the bedside crib, as it can be difficult to assemble. The instructions are a bit confusing, especially when it comes time to attach it to your bed. But she says it's worth the effort since it's a beautiful cot that's robust and easy to clean.
MFM mother home test Jasmine loved the way the bedside crib looked in her bedroom and how well it held up to daily use. She also appreciated the dimensions of the crib, she said it was larger than a Moses basket, but not too big. She also said it was easy to find the bedding and that it is of good quality.
It is essential to remember that a crib next to the bed is not a substitute for a baby sleeping bag, or swaddle. This is not a way to ensure a safe sleep. Back To Sleep campaign guidelines suggest that your child sleep on their backs in their crib or cot. It is also essential to remove any pillows, duvets or blankets that might hinder your baby's breathing.

A bedside crib travel cot will help your baby sleep comfortably when you are away from home. You can monitor them while they sleep, and you have a safe place to change their diaper. However, before you buy a bedside crib, examine its safety features. Be sure it is in compliance with British standards and is easy to clean.
A quality bedside crib should have mesh sides to let air flow in, and it should be easy to clean. It should be simple to move from room to room. A sturdy frame and a high-quality mattress are crucial. The bedding should be snugly over the mattress and not have any gaps or loose fabric.
Another crucial aspect to take into consideration is the size of your baby's. Some travel cots can be somewhat bulky, while others fold into an incredibly compact size that can easily be tucked away into a suitcase or the back of your car. Some even have an accompanying bag.

Most (but not all) airlines let you use a portable crib for free and it's worth taking into consideration your needs when browsing alternatives. Some travel cribs are so small that they can be tucked away in the suitcase of. This is great for travel. Check airline regulations before buying a travel crib. Some are bigger and must be checked as luggage. It's also important to take into consideration the frequency you will use the travel cot to determine its weight, size and function.
